GEOGRAPHY

  • Located in South America
  • Bordered by Colombia to the west and Guyana to the east
  • Also bordered by Brazil to the south, the Caribbean Sea, and the North Atlantic Ocean
  • Hot and humid, more moderate in the highlands

CARACAS

  • Largest city in Venezuela
  • Located in northern Venezuela
  • One of Latin America's most modern cities
  • Cosmopolitan city with a fast-growing population

ANGEL FALLS

  • Highest waterfall in the world
  • 5 times taller than Niagara Falls
  • Located in the Guayana highlands
  • In Canaima National Park
  • 979 meters tall

POPULATION

  • 30,976,873 people
  • Official language is Spanish
  • 96% Roman Catholic, 2% Protestant, and 2% other
  • Consists mostly of Spanish, Italian, Portuguese, Arab, German, African, indigenous people
  • 41st most populous country

EXPORTS

  • Highly dependent of oil revenues
  • It accounts for 96% of export earnings
  • Petroleum and petroleum products, minerals, chemicals
